Transaction 18615bb7cb6f9ba45e91c73ef3c535d3514f76c8c032a328d2917539c1250242
1 Input
1 Output
-
18615bb7cb6f9ba45e91c73ef3c535d3514f76c8c032a328d2917539c1250242:0
- value
- 172913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 218eda490b49304e07fa47c8ec3e56af59f1b046 OP_EQUAL
- address
- 34kTMTBLtuJeM5QeVQkPYPVTinp4jqMVfr